Results for "mookata pan"

A Mookata pan is a specialized cooking device that combines grilling and stewing, popular in Thai cuisine. It features a unique design with a dome-shaped grill in the center and a surrounding moat for broth.

FAQs

How do I use a Mookata pan?

To use a Mookata pan, heat it on the stove or grill, add a small amount of oil to the grill surface, and place your marinated meats and vegetables on top while simmering broth in the surrounding moat.

What types of food can I cook with a Mookata pan?

You can cook a variety of foods, including marinated meats, fresh vegetables, seafood, and even noodles, making it versatile for different tastes.

Is a Mookata pan easy to clean?

Yes, most Mookata pans have a non-stick surface that makes cleaning easy. Simply soak and wipe down after use to maintain its quality.

Can I use a Mookata pan indoors?

Yes, you can use a Mookata pan indoors on a stovetop or electric grill, making it convenient for year-round cooking.

What makes Mookata different from traditional barbecues?

Mookata combines grilling and stewing, allowing you to cook and enjoy a variety of flavors simultaneously, unlike traditional barbecues that focus solely on grilling.
